Output 577d584153e7abaf25490e7393e09f67920530bc3c30e7e7fb0d2ebcef8000c3:2

value
530000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47a4824693ac870498773c81bbde2fd346d34df4 OP_EQUAL
address
38DpySaFm1NFmLFoM5E3jbaXp7Jpez6WBY
transaction
577d584153e7abaf25490e7393e09f67920530bc3c30e7e7fb0d2ebcef8000c3
confirmations
387265
spent
true